dtdocbook: on some systems SIGLOST = SIGPWR and they should not be in the same case statement.

This commit is contained in:
William Schaub
2012-08-16 13:55:41 -04:00
committed by Jon Trulson
parent 2532f4a5ba
commit 727b47894c

View File

@@ -1009,7 +1009,7 @@ Tcl_SignalId(sig)
#ifdef SIGPROF
case SIGPROF: return "SIGPROF";
#endif
#if defined(SIGPWR) && (!defined(SIGXFSZ) || (SIGPWR != SIGXFSZ))
#if defined(SIGPWR) && (SIGPWR != SIGLOST) && (!defined(SIGXFSZ) || (SIGPWR != SIGXFSZ))
case SIGPWR: return "SIGPWR";
#endif
#ifdef SIGQUIT
@@ -1141,7 +1141,7 @@ Tcl_SignalMsg(sig)
#ifdef SIGPROF
case SIGPROF: return "profiling alarm";
#endif
#if defined(SIGPWR) && (!defined(SIGXFSZ) || (SIGPWR != SIGXFSZ))
#if defined(SIGPWR) && (SIGPWR != SIGLOST) && (!defined(SIGXFSZ) || (SIGPWR != SIGXFSZ))
case SIGPWR: return "power-fail restart";
#endif
#ifdef SIGQUIT